Envy Has Friend's


It Is Written, Galatians 5:19-21, now the works of the flesh are evident, which are; adultery, fornication, uncleanness, lewdness, idolatry, sorcery, hatred, contentions, jealousies, outbursts of wrath, selfish ambitions, deceptions, heresies, envy, murders, drunkenness, rivalries, and the like; of which I tell you before hand, just as I told you in time past, that those who practice such things will not inherit the kingdom of God.
Envy is defined as a feeling of discontented or resentful longing, aroused by someone else's possessions, qualities, or luck. As you can see from the above verse, envy keeps company with a lot of other sinful things according to the Lord.
Many people use expressions such as, I envy so-and-so's great job, house, car, or whatever. You may have even said or felt what is often called, a little jealous.
There is no such thing as a little sin in God's eyes. Maybe that is because every evil thought, leads to other evil thoughts. Envy and its closest sister jealousy, can even lead to anger against God. People blame God because they don't have what they think they deserve. There is no need to make any other kind of a list of possible sins, they are all listed in Galatians 5:19-21, today's verse.
